我开发了一个Java GUI应用程序,它使用MS Access作为数据库。但是,经过我的研究,我才知道它只能存储2 GB的数据。现在我计划用其他数据库替换它。
Which is the free and easy to use sql database?
答案 0 :(得分:3)
与MySQL DB的Java连接:
http://www.vogella.com/articles/MySQLJava/article.html
Step By Step Explanation: http://www.roseindia.net/jdbc/jdbc-mysql/MysqlConnect.shtml
Apache Derby:
It is Relational Database similar to MySQl developed by Apache.
Tomcat服务器
As name says, it is a server, which listens to request on particular port, process dynamic request and respond back to client.
答案 1 :(得分:1)
下载mysql并使用它。您可以从here
下载答案 2 :(得分:1)
我认为Apache Derby是一个主要用于测试目的的数据库,我认为它只能由Java应用程序访问。
因此,我推荐MySQL作为一个免费且易于使用的SQL数据库。 IMO,MS Access不是一个合适的数据库,它是一个玩具数据库。
答案 3 :(得分:1)
您可以使用 MySql数据库。您可以从here下载。您需要 JDBC驱动程序才能连接到MySql,您可以获取{{ 3}}。如果您使用的是 Java 7,那么JDBC 4 将会存在。只需将驱动程序jar文件放在类路径中即可。它会自动被选中。无需执行Class.forName("someDriver");
答案 4 :(得分:1)
您可以使用Mysql数据库或sql server数据库....
要使用mysql,您可以在此处阅读:http://dev.mysql.com/doc/connector-j/en/connector-j-usagenotes-connect-drivermanager.html